The main focus when treating ear infections is to relieve pain and treat the infection if bacteria is causing it. Prescription treatments are often required to treat bacterial ear infections, and over-the-counter treatments can be effective in relieving pain from viral ear infections.Â
Antibiotics may be needed for more severe ear infections to clear up the infection effectively.
Antibacterial prescription sprays such as Otomize Ear Spray effectively treat ear infections as they spray antibiotics directly into the ear canal to fight the infection.Â

Ear infections often follow a sore throat, cold, or upper respiratory infection. If bacteria or viruses cause this initial infection, it can spread to the middle ear through your Eustachian tubes (a tube that connects your ear to your throat) and cause infection in your ear.Â

To help prevent ear infections, you should maintain good hygiene by regularly washing your hands, avoiding being around smoky environments, and avoiding water or shampoo getting into your ears.
Many ear infections can heal without antibiotics as the body’s immune system often combats the infection. However, you should monitor symptoms closely, especially in children. Travelling by air or staying at high altitudes can be uncomfortable with an ear infection due to changing air pressure, so you should avoid flying if the infection is severe.
Ear infections can sometimes lead to more severe issues, including ongoing hearing problems, if not treated properly, especially in chronic or recurrent infections. In rare cases, the infection can spread to nearby areas like the bones or the brain, which is why treatment is important.
Doctors diagnose ear infections mainly by using a tool called an otoscope to look inside the ear and check for signs of infection like redness, swelling, or fluid. They might also ask about symptoms like pain, hearing loss, and fever.
